More album samples

I got some new albums in the other day, some for me and some for a client. Yolaunda and Nathan got married at Mt Washington at New Years last year, and I’m totally in love with their album design.

There’s the leatherette 10×10 feature album (for Yolaunda and Nathan), an 8×8 parents copy (a studio sample), two 6×6 parents copies (again, for them), a whole bunch of 4×4 pocket book copies (for everyone) and a calendar (a freebie for the couple). First up I’ll show you the calendar. This is just a basic freebie that comes with all my basic album orders (and parent book orders too). There’s two months per page, so 7 pictures all together. The paper has a nice texture to it too, it’s quite a nice little bonus for ordering from this company.

Next up is the feature album. This is a 10×10 basic flush mount album with 24 spreads. As you can see, we opted for the photo and names on the front cover. A similar album would retail for $1,175.

Next up are the parent books. There are two sizes, but the binding and other construction are identical. They have a black linen hard cover, with a metallic photo dust cover and the designs are an exact duplicate of the main album. The pages are regilar paper, where the feature is photo paper, but they are bound in a similar way, so they have no image loss at the center, just like the flush mount albums. They come as a set of one 8×8, two 6x6s or four 4x4s for $485.

Comparing the two sizes, 8×8 and 6×6.

Next up are the pocket books. These little guys are so freaking cute! They’re fairly stiff metallic covers, again with the duplicate design inside. The pages are paper, similar to my coffee table books, and again bound in a a way that allows images to cross the gutter with no loss. There are some stickes visible, but they aren’t too distracting. The covers are about half way between a floppy soft cover and a hard cover. They are available as a set of eight for $290.

Last but not least, a couple more comparisons of all the albums together! Once again, a leatherette 10×10 basic flush mount, 8×8 parents book, 6×6 parents book, and a 4×4 pocket book.
